Hello everyone!

So I've finally decided to sell my CyberStormPPC as you can see here:

http://www.tradera.com/item/301822/212561164/cyberstormppc

It includes 96MB RAM and has never been overclocked. The PPC is clocked at 233MHz and the 060 at 50MHz.

I would prefer to sell to someone in Sweden or even close to where I live but I do ship it to the neighbour countries as well.

I hope that it will come to good use!

@NutsAboutAmiga

IMO it's kind of a nice experience and it's the very best CPU-card that you can get for the A3000/A4000. So if you use one of those it's a nice upgrade. Also the price isn't very different from when it's new and that was without RAM.

I can see what you mean but we are all different apperently.

@Xmas87

You do not need to spend lots of money on it, you can "waste" a lot of time though

I personal would not want to spend more than 800 EUR for a 20 years old accellerator that can fail tomorrow (and you have no chance to get any money back). The new accellerator from Apollo team plus a used A500 is much more affordable and justifyable to me. And till then I can use my environment on modern hardware using UAE. But I know that people think different and are willing to spend lots of money on old cards.

Break? I do not know. If people are willing to spend the money and get what was promised be it. For me there must be a relation between money and what you get, 800 EUR for a card is much too much, for that I get a brandnew notebook with everything included so it would not be justifyable to me.
